黃錦陽
摘 要:用于直觀描述被檢樣品外觀、標(biāo)識(shí)等照片是確保檢測(cè)結(jié)果可追溯性的重要證據(jù)之一,也是試驗(yàn)報(bào)告中最直觀地反映被測(cè)定樣品主要結(jié)構(gòu)的重要依據(jù),更是保證檢驗(yàn)報(bào)告質(zhì)量的重要內(nèi)容之一。分析了質(zhì)檢機(jī)構(gòu)接樣后樣品拍照功能的設(shè)計(jì)與應(yīng)用,并通過兩種采集設(shè)備運(yùn)用不同的拍照技術(shù)對(duì)樣品進(jìn)行拍照處理,對(duì)比了兩種拍照技術(shù)的優(yōu)缺點(diǎn),闡述了照片與實(shí)物之間的對(duì)應(yīng)關(guān)系,方便樣品照片的查詢與追溯,大幅提高了樣品拍照的效率,滿足了實(shí)驗(yàn)室質(zhì)量管理的要求,有效提升了實(shí)驗(yàn)室管樣品管理的自動(dòng)化和信息化水平。
關(guān)鍵詞:質(zhì)檢機(jī)構(gòu);樣品管理;樣品拍照;照片采集
中圖分類號(hào):R197.2 文獻(xiàn)標(biāo)識(shí)碼:A DOI:10.15913/j.cnki.kjycx.2016.23.086
近年來,隨著人們對(duì)商品質(zhì)量的重視,檢測(cè)機(jī)構(gòu)的業(yè)務(wù)量不斷增長,給實(shí)驗(yàn)室管理帶來一大問題,特別是樣品管理。傳統(tǒng)的樣品照片操作流程為:①樣品管理員核對(duì)待拍照樣品的信息,包括樣品編號(hào)、樣品描述、數(shù)量等信息;②通過相機(jī)對(duì)樣品進(jìn)行拍照,上傳到電腦,運(yùn)用第三方圖片處理對(duì)樣品照片的尺寸大小裁剪或是直接插入到Word里進(jìn)行編輯;③上傳樣品照片,打印出樣品照片的樣品卡。待測(cè)試報(bào)告出來完成后,將人工匹配報(bào)告與樣品照片一起裝訂,如果報(bào)告中需體現(xiàn)商標(biāo)或查詢洗水嘜等信息,報(bào)告編制人員需到指定的共享文件夾找到相應(yīng)的圖片。顯然,這種方法效率很低,而且在匹配過程中容易出錯(cuò),工作質(zhì)量很難以保證。鑒于種種問題與弊端,本單位開發(fā)樣品拍照軟件來解決這些問題。
1 實(shí)現(xiàn)功能
1.1 設(shè)備參數(shù)設(shè)置及其配置功能
為了獲取更好質(zhì)量的圖片,可設(shè)置相機(jī)參數(shù)。例如AEMode Select、ISO、Av、Tv、MeteringMode、ExposureCompensatio.
在保存圖片前請(qǐng)選擇目標(biāo)圖片所屬類型,類型包括樣品外觀、吊牌、洗水嘜等,也可以自定義類型。自定義類型可在設(shè)置模塊中增、刪、修類型的名稱。
設(shè)置保存圖片大小。保存圖片時(shí)會(huì)根據(jù)設(shè)置的圖片大小保存到文件服務(wù)器。
壓縮比設(shè)置。圖像壓縮是指以較少的比特有損或無損地表示原來的像素矩陣的技術(shù),也稱圖像編碼。是去除多余數(shù)據(jù),以數(shù)學(xué)的觀點(diǎn)來看,這一過程實(shí)際上就是將二維像素陣列變換為一個(gè)在統(tǒng)計(jì)上無關(guān)聯(lián)的數(shù)據(jù)集合。
相機(jī)保存高質(zhì)量的圖片最高可達(dá)到數(shù)M,為了不影響軟件的正常讀取速度,因此對(duì)目標(biāo)圖片進(jìn)行壓縮。根據(jù)業(yè)務(wù)的實(shí)際要求設(shè)置相應(yīng)的百分比。
1.2 定位樣品在軟件中的記錄
操作人員在本軟件上用條碼槍采集貼在樣品上的條碼,系統(tǒng)會(huì)自動(dòng)定位到該樣品在系統(tǒng)中所對(duì)應(yīng)的記錄。操作人員核對(duì)樣品與軟件中的顯示信息是否一致。確認(rèn)無誤方可將樣品放至燈箱內(nèi),燈箱中間正上方固定住攝像頭或單反相機(jī)等采集設(shè)備,樣品放至攝像頭的正下方。
1.3 圖片預(yù)覽功能
點(diǎn)擊“拍照預(yù)覽”,通過攝像頭或單反相機(jī)可以實(shí)時(shí)顯示預(yù)覽圖片的樣品的狀態(tài),操作人員根據(jù)軟件中的預(yù)效果對(duì)樣品實(shí)物進(jìn)行調(diào)整。對(duì)于大物件的樣品,需要拍到完整的樣品;對(duì)于小樣品或吊牌、洗水嘜等需要用自動(dòng)對(duì)焦或手動(dòng)調(diào)整焦距,特別是吊牌、洗水嘜需能清楚地在圖片上顯示其內(nèi)容。點(diǎn)擊“自動(dòng)對(duì)焦”按鈕即控制相機(jī)的對(duì)焦功能。待樣品調(diào)整到最佳效果即可保存。
1.4 圖片保存
選擇圖片所屬類型,點(diǎn)擊“保存圖片”按鈕,軟件會(huì)根據(jù)相機(jī)上的相應(yīng)參數(shù)及壓縮比進(jìn)行保存,并將圖片傳至文件服務(wù)器上的相應(yīng)文件夾。文件服務(wù)器上一份報(bào)告對(duì)一個(gè)文件夾,其名稱用報(bào)告編號(hào)命名,圖片文件命名格式為“年月日時(shí)分秒序號(hào)”,文件夾+圖片名組成一樣唯一的路徑,避免了重名現(xiàn)象。在沒有特殊要求的情況下,軟件會(huì)自動(dòng)將圖片的大小可以壓縮到100 K左右。如果需要高清圖,圖片根據(jù)壓縮比做出相應(yīng)壓縮。
1.5 圖片編輯
圖片編輯步驟為:①圖片可任意角度的旋轉(zhuǎn)。圖片依據(jù)輸入旋轉(zhuǎn)角度值隨之旋轉(zhuǎn)。②圖片尺寸裁剪。操作員可選定目標(biāo)區(qū)域雙擊即可將選中區(qū)域外去掉。區(qū)域可以是方形、圓形等形狀。③縮放功能。圖片按照設(shè)置縮放比例進(jìn)行放大或縮小。
1.6 圖片調(diào)用及打印
該樣品的項(xiàng)目檢測(cè)結(jié)束后,編制人員編制報(bào)告時(shí),會(huì)自動(dòng)顯示該樣品所有圖片,商標(biāo)會(huì)自動(dòng)插入到對(duì)應(yīng)報(bào)告商標(biāo)位置。并根據(jù)客戶要求,自動(dòng)將樣品外觀圖片調(diào)入到報(bào)告照片頁的相應(yīng)位置。如果存在多張圖片,會(huì)以一行兩張格式進(jìn)行排列。
目前彩打打印機(jī)原裝墨盒耗材相對(duì)較貴;黑白的打印機(jī)是激光打印機(jī),使用的是墨粉,耗材便宜。為了節(jié)約成本。報(bào)告打印時(shí),圖片會(huì)自動(dòng)從彩打打印機(jī)打印出來,其他非圖片頁從黑白打印機(jī)打印出來,不需要人工干預(yù),可以大大節(jié)約墨盒成本。
另外,操作員可以單獨(dú)打印選中的圖片,也可以根據(jù)報(bào)告編號(hào)列表批量打印出圖片。相關(guān)聯(lián)的報(bào)告使用同一樣品試樣無需重復(fù)執(zhí)行拍照動(dòng)作,軟件會(huì)自動(dòng)調(diào)用相關(guān)報(bào)告的圖片。
2 實(shí)現(xiàn)拍照的兩種技術(shù)
2.1 攝像頭采集程序
通過攝像頭采集程序利用DirectShow從攝像頭中采集數(shù)據(jù)。
DirectShow是微軟公司在Active Movie和Video for Windows的基礎(chǔ)上推出的新一代基于COM(Component Object Model)的流媒體處理的開發(fā)包,與DirectX開發(fā)包一起發(fā)布。DirectShow使用一種叫Filter Graph的模型來管理整個(gè)數(shù)據(jù)流的處理過程,運(yùn)用DirectShow,我們可以很方便地從支持WDM驅(qū)動(dòng)模型的采集卡上捕獲數(shù)據(jù),并進(jìn)行相應(yīng)的后期處理,并存儲(chǔ)到文件中。這樣使在多媒體數(shù)據(jù)庫管理系統(tǒng)(MDBMS)中多媒體數(shù)據(jù)的存取變得更加方便。它支持各種媒體格式,包括ASF、Mpeg、Avi、DV、Mp3、Wave等,為多媒體流的捕捉和回放提供了強(qiáng)有力的支持。
優(yōu)點(diǎn):預(yù)覽功能實(shí)現(xiàn)很簡(jiǎn)單。因?yàn)镈irectShow本身就有播放視頻的功能,所以只需通過VideoFile中的FilterGraph利用內(nèi)存流技術(shù)與Play方法就可以顯示在軟件中實(shí)時(shí)成像。
缺點(diǎn):視頻格式一般只有幾種,包括MJPG 640X480,24 bits;MJPG 640X480,24 bits;VideoInfo2 MJPG 320X240,24 bits;MJPG 800X600,24 bits;MJPG 160X120,24 bits;MJPG 1280X720,24 bits;MJPG 1600X1200,24 bits等,分辨率不是很高,無法達(dá)到高清圖片的標(biāo)準(zhǔn)。另外,深色的樣品拍攝的圖片會(huì)存在色差,有時(shí)候產(chǎn)生色差極大,實(shí)物與圖片之間的顏色完全不一樣。而質(zhì)檢樣品圖片不允許有色差。
2.2 單反相機(jī)采集程序
通過單反相機(jī)來采集程序。本軟件以某品牌單反相機(jī)為例,軟件兼容該品牌單反相機(jī)各型號(hào)。
該品牌單反相機(jī)提供讓開發(fā)者調(diào)用的SDK接口,本軟件調(diào)用其相關(guān)接口方法函數(shù)進(jìn)行開發(fā),開發(fā)時(shí)參照如下11個(gè)步驟:①初始化和終止SDK;②打開和關(guān)閉攝像頭會(huì)話;③獲取連接的像機(jī)列表;④set和get相機(jī)設(shè)置;⑤獲取可用的設(shè)置列表;⑥正常拍照和使用閃光燈模式;⑦處理相機(jī)事件;⑧將拍攝的照片下載到電腦上;⑨啟動(dòng)和實(shí)時(shí)查看;⑩記錄實(shí)時(shí)查看;○11鎖定/解鎖相機(jī)的用戶界面。
優(yōu)點(diǎn):①單鏡頭反光相機(jī)可以隨意換用與其配套的各種廣角、中焦距、遠(yuǎn)攝或變焦距鏡頭,也能根據(jù)需要在鏡頭安裝近攝鏡、加接延伸接環(huán)或伸縮皮腔,拍攝圖片質(zhì)量相當(dāng)好。②對(duì)環(huán)境的自適應(yīng)較強(qiáng),圖片存在色差相對(duì)小。如果存在色差可以在“白平衡”這個(gè)功能調(diào)整。③單反相機(jī)拍的照片最大分辨率為5 184×3 456,因此可拍攝出清晰度極高的圖片。
缺點(diǎn):預(yù)覽功能實(shí)現(xiàn)比較復(fù)雜。
本軟件同時(shí)兼容上述兩種設(shè)備,操作員可根據(jù)實(shí)驗(yàn)樣品要求選擇合適的設(shè)備來獲取圖片。
3 數(shù)據(jù)庫設(shè)計(jì)
參考文獻(xiàn)
[1]董燕,劉玉英.國家實(shí)驗(yàn)室認(rèn)可后實(shí)驗(yàn)室檢測(cè)樣品管理和信息系統(tǒng)應(yīng)用效果分析[J].實(shí)用醫(yī)技雜志,2008(06).
[2]王愛萍.國家認(rèn)可實(shí)驗(yàn)室信息化管理系統(tǒng)應(yīng)用體會(huì)[J].中國公共衛(wèi)生管理,2011(06).
[3]李華.建立優(yōu)良的實(shí)驗(yàn)室自動(dòng)化解決方案[J].現(xiàn)代科學(xué)儀器,2002(2).
[4]李世軍.基于DSP的數(shù)字圖像采集、壓縮系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n)[J].電子技術(shù)應(yīng)用,2009(7).
〔編輯:王霞〕